What is biohazard cleanup?
Biohazard cleanup involves the safe removal, cleaning, and disinfection of biological contaminants such as blood, bodily fluids, and other potentially infectious materials. This process is performed by trained professionals using specialized equipment and protective gear to ensure safety and restore the affected area.
What types of situations require biohazard cleanup?
Common situations include unattended deaths, traumatic events, crime scenes, medical accidents, industrial incidents, and cases involving infectious waste. Any scenario where bodily fluids pose a health risk may require professional biohazard remediation.
Is biohazard cleanup dangerous?
Yes, handling blood and bodily fluids can expose individuals to bloodborne pathogens and other infectious diseases. Professional cleanup crews use personal protective equipment (PPE), hospital-grade disinfectants, and strict protocols to minimize risk during and after the process.

How do you ensure the area is fully sanitized?
We follow industry-standard procedures that include removing all biohazardous materials, cleaning with EPA-registered disinfectants, and using techniques such as fogging to treat hard-to-reach surfaces. We then verify the area is safe for reoccupation.
